I am using buddyboss / buddypress and they have a feature where they show custom posts in the activity feed, but for some reason custom posts created using toolset do not show up in the activity feed. initially i thought it was a buddyboss issue so i contacted their support but after their investigation they are believe the error is on the toolset side.

Thanks for the details, I have done below modifications in your website:
1) Dashboard-> Snippets, add an item "Custom post type in buddypress", with below codes:

add_post_type_support( 'my-top-10', 'buddypress-activity' );

2) Dashboard-> BuddyBoss-> Settings, in section "Custom Post Types", enable option "My Top 10 Books"

3) Create a "My Top 10 Books" post: test 123, test it in frontend:
hidden link
It works fine, see my screenshot test-123.jpg

It is actually a buddypress issue, you just need to follow their document to setup the custom PHP codes, see their document here:
